Victorian Phoenix Athletes Selected for 2025 U20 World Championships

Water Polo Australia has officially announced the 20&U Men’s team set to compete at the 2025 World Aquatics U20 Men’s Water Polo Championships, to be held in Zagreb, Croatia from 14–21 June.

We are incredibly proud to congratulate Daniel Magasanik and Nick Mordes on their selection in the Australian team. This is a tremendous achievement and a testament to the dedication, discipline, and hard work they have shown throughout the season.

Daniel’s selection follows his recent debut with the Ord Minnett Aussie Sharks, marking an exciting chapter in his water polo journey.

A squad of 15 athletes has been selected to represent Australia on the world stage, following the final selection camp held in Sydney at the conclusion of the 2025 Australian Water Polo League finals.

20&U Men’s Head Coach Dragan Bakic said:

“It has been a pleasure to work with this group of athletes up until this point, and I look forward to seeing how this group can grow and develop as we continue to work towards the World Championships.
The World Championships are the pinnacle event on the calendar for our pathway athletes, and the boys should be proud of their selection to represent Australia in Croatia.”
